Leverage Multidisciplinary Approaches for Comprehensive Care

When it comes to autism care, a multidisciplinary approach is key! It’s all about teamwork among psychologists, speech therapists, occupational therapists, and educators. This collaboration ensures that every part of a young person’s development gets the attention it deserves.

For instance, when speech and occupational therapists join forces, they can work on communication skills while also boosting fine motor abilities. This kind of teamwork leads to more holistic development, which is something we all want for our kids!

Research shows that young people receiving this kind of support make significant strides in areas like socialization and adaptive functioning. In fact, a whopping 86.5% of community-based providers have referred patients for support services, highlighting just how valuable these coordinated efforts can be.

Engage Families in the Autism Support Process

Family engagement is so important for effective autism support! Involving families in therapy sessions, goal-setting, and progress monitoring can really boost treatment outcomes. For instance, parent-mediated programs that let caregivers practice skills at home have shown to significantly improve kids' communication and social skills.

Research shows that young people whose families actively participate in their therapy see greater gains in adaptive functioning. In fact, studies reveal an effect size of 0.55 for parent-implemented interventions! Caregiver training is a key part of this process, helping caregivers understand ABA principles and strategies better. This knowledge empowers them to make informed decisions that positively impact their child's development.

So, what are some effective ways to engage families? Offering training sessions, keeping regular communication about progress, and creating spaces for families to share insights and concerns are great starts.
